Ministry of Home Affairs

The Ministry of Home Affairs is a key government department in India. It oversees internal security and domestic policy. The ministry manages law and order, immigration, and disaster management. It also handles the administration of Union Territories. The ministry plays a vital role in shaping national security strategies. Its functions are crucial for maintaining peace and stability in the country.
